Poor Posture

Poor posture — including forward head posture, rounded shoulders, and hyperkyphosis (hunchback) — places chronic strain on the spine and surrounding muscles. Over time, this leads to pain, stiffness, and accelerated disc wear. Our chiropractors conduct postural assessments to identify imbalances and provide a tailored programme of adjustments, specific exercises, and ergonomic advice. Headaches and Migraines

Many headaches originate in the neck — known as cervicogenic headaches. When the upper cervical vertebrae are misaligned, they can irritate the nerves and muscles that refer pain into the head. Chiropractic adjustments to the upper cervical spine, combined with soft tissue therapy, can significantly reduce both the frequency and intensity of tension headaches and some migraines.

Scoliosis

Scoliosis is an abnormal lateral curvature of the spine, most commonly developing during childhood and adolescence. While chiropractic care cannot straighten the spine in established scoliosis, regular adjustments can help manage associated pain, improve posture, slow progression in some cases, and maintain spinal mobility. We work alongside other healthcare providers for patients with significant scoliosis.

Sciatica

Sciatica refers to pain, numbness, or tingling that radiates from the lower back down through the buttock and into the leg — following the path of the sciatic nerve. It is commonly caused by a disc herniation or spinal stenosis compressing the nerve root in the lumbar spine. Chiropractic adjustments and flexion-distraction techniques can decompress the affected nerve and provide lasting relief.
